Feasibility study of the pharmacology of local application of amifostine (WR-2721) to the buccal mucosa in guinea pigs

摘要

Background/Aims: We have undertaken this study to investigate the feasibility of topical application of the radioprotective compound WR-2721 to the buccal mucosa. Methods: Saliva samples were collected from 5 volunteers and were reconstituted in 3 amifostine solutions. Measurements of amifostine and WR-1065 contents were performed at 6 different time points. Young-adult guinea pigs were topically administered amifostine 50 and 100 mg to each buccal mucosa. At 0, 15 and 30 min after application, the blood samples obtained from the heart and the buccal tissues were prepared for the analysis of amifostine and WR-1065. Results: There was no significant difference between the 3 concentrations of amifostine in saliva in vitro at any of the 6 study time points (p > 0.05). No WR-1065 was detected in saliva. In the guinea pigs from groups A and B, there were significant differences in concentrations of amifostine and WR-1065 in the tissues between the 0-min and 15-min subgroups and between the 0-min and 30-min subgroups (p < 0.05). The concentrations of amifostine and WR-1065 from the 15-min and 30-min subgroups did not differ statistically (p > 0.05). Conclusions: It is feasible to administer topical amifostine (WR-2721) to mucosa to prevent radiation-induced oral mucositis, and systemic absorption is negligible. Relatively high concentrations of amifostine in human saliva in vitro were maintained, although some inconsistent changes are observed.
